Output 18dd7d1bc9015fcf526d2cd4b1cee768097b1073f4ea7afdacdd147edef2c17c:2

value
30649620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eed168c304e97e8a4729a98a0e5b6636543d30c OP_EQUAL
address
MLvtCqar99DPpk9ZyE9fEFSie74CKbtHXb
transaction
18dd7d1bc9015fcf526d2cd4b1cee768097b1073f4ea7afdacdd147edef2c17c
spent
true